This adaptation of Rudyard Kipling’s The Jungle Book is set in Africa and made relevant for young people today, touching on issues of belonging and identity. Mowgli is a young girl who is lost and does not fit in, but is made to feel like she belongs by her new family in the wilds. Until they are threatened…
Deborah Gildenhuys is a drama teacher and director with 37 years experience and ran Spotlight Drama Studio for 27 years, providing drama classes, drama exam training and producing plays for young people . In 2023 she decided to re open as Spotlight Youth Theatre committed to producuing quality theatre for young people with young people.
Our Jungle Story is directed by Lauren Bates, one of the earlier members of the Studio. Lauren is now a Shakespeare Masters Graduate, a Teacher and Theatre Practitioner in her own right and is the founder of Educasions, a Theatre group who dramatise school setworks.
Melanie O’Çonnor Horn is an experienced teacher of English and Drama, involved in theatre marketing and encouraging new playwrights, as well as being a writer herself.
The cast is made up of young people from schools around the peninsula from the ages of 9-16 all with a love of acting and story-telling.
